Monacoin Mining Guide: Hardware, Algorithm & Resources
Monacoin (MONA), Japan’s first digital currency, was created in December 2013. The Monacoin community is Japan’s most active digital currency community.
Monacoin is mined via Proof of Work under the Lyra2REv2 algorithm.

1. Obtain suitable hardware
✅ Monacoin can be efficiently mined with ASIC mining machines.
❌ Monacoin cannot be efficiently mined with CPU or GPU cards.
View our Miners page to discover the most profitable ASIC machines for Monacoin mining.
2. Obtain a wallet address
A Monacoin wallet address is required for you to receive and monitor your mining revenue. f2pool distributes mining revenues on a daily basis to every user who reaches the payout threshold, which is 10 MONA. f2pool’s payout scheme is 4% PPS.
If you do not yet have an Monacoin address, you’ll need to get one from the wallet list on Monacoin’s official website. You can also choose an exchange, such as Bitbank or Zaif. Note: You should always do your own due diligence when choosing a wallet provider or exchange.
3. Configure your mining device
Your miner must be connected to the f2pool server listed below for your hashrate and revenue to be recorded and monitored.
You’ll need to enter the following information in your mining device:
URL: stratum+tcp://mona.f2pool.com:20593
Username: walletAddress.workerName
Password: Your choice
Please note
workerName is optional, but we recommend labeling each of your mining devices with a separate workerName for more efficient monitoring.
